Connection string nie łączy z bazą

0

witam
Od niedawna zacząłem się interesować technologią asp.net mvc i mam pewien problem mianowicie gdy inicjalizuje bazę danych w webconfigu i chcę żeby została stworzona pod określoną nazwą w app_data występuje błąd inicjalizacji a gdy nie podaje tego parametru wszystko działa ok

Ta wersja nie działa:

<add name="Baza" connectionString="Data Source=(LocalDb)\v11.0;Initial Catalog=BazaDB;Integrated Security=SSPI;AttachDBFilename=|DataDirectory|\Baza.mdf" 
         providerName="System.Data.SqlClient" /> 

A ta wersja działa

<add name="Baza" connectionString="Data Source=(LocalDb)\v11.0;Initial Catalog=BazaDB;Integrated Security=SSPI;" 
         providerName="System.Data.SqlClient" /> 

A i błąd

 An exception of type 'System.Data.DataException' occurred in EntityFramework.dll but was not handled in user code

Additional information: An exception occurred while initializing the database. See the InnerException for details.

Czy ktoś z was mógłby mi pomóc ?

1

Pokaż co masz w InnerException. Możesz spróbować też takiego connection string:

<add name="Baza" connectionString="Data Source=(LocalDb)\v11.0;AttachDbFilename=|DataDirectory|\Baza.mdf;Initial Catalog=Baza;Integrated Security=True"
providerName="System.Data.SqlClient" /

Możesz też spróbować:

AttachDbFilename=|DataDirectory|Baza.mdf;

Ten \ i tak nie ma znaczenia.

0

zmieniłem nazwę bazy na inną i przeszło normalnie już :) temat można zamknąć

1 użytkowników online, w tym zalogowanych: 0, gości: 1